This is not a marketing warning meant to create urgency: it is the reality of the quota system that Peru\u2019s Ministry of Culture has applied since 2021 to limit the impact of mass tourism on the site. During high season, tickets for the most requested time slots can sell out weeks or even months before the travel date. Anyone who discovers this after already buying flights and booking a hotel in Cusco needs real options, not advice that arrives too late. Availability on that portal is updated in real time and reflects cancellations that occur daily when other visitors modify their reservations.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">Tickets that were sold out a week ago may have availability today due to last-minute cancellations. This movement is more common than it seems, especially in the days leading up to dates when the weather may be uncertain, because some travelers cancel preventively when the forecast is unfavorable. Checking the official portal early in the morning, when cancellations from other time zones are more frequently processed, is more likely to show availability than checking at other times of the day.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<figure class=\"wp-block-image size-large\"><img loading=\"lazy\" decoding=\"async\" width=\"1024\" height=\"425\" src=\"https:\/\/incredibleperutours.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/image-4-1024x425.png\" alt=\"Machu Picchu booking platform\" class=\"wp-image-7437\" srcset=\"https:\/\/incredibleperutours.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/image-4-1024x425.png 1024w, https:\/\/incredibleperutours.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/image-4-300x125.png 300w, https:\/\/incredibleperutours.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/image-4-768x319.png 768w, https:\/\/incredibleperutours.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/image-4-1536x638.png 1536w, https:\/\/incredibleperutours.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/image-4.png 1830w\" sizes=\"auto, (max-width: 1024px) 100vw, 1024px\" \/><figcaption class=\"wp-element-caption\">Book Machu Picchu tickets on the Ministry portal 5 months in advance for the circuit with the highest demand<\/figcaption><\/figure>\n\n\n\n<h2 class=\"wp-block-heading\">Second: Look for Alternative dates Within the Same Trip<\/h2>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">If the original date is sold out, the simplest solution is to move the visit one or two days within the available margin of the itinerary. Tuesdays and Wednesdays usually have more availability than Saturdays and Sundays at any time of year, because the flow of organized groups arriving on weekends is higher. If the itinerary has some flexibility, searching for weekday dates may open availability where the weekend was completely full.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">The time slot is also a variable that can solve the problem without changing the date. If the 6:00 a.m. slot is sold out but the 9:00 a.m. or midday slot still has availability, the site is still the same. The difference in the experience exists, but it is not as decisive as it may seem before visiting the site: Machu Picchu at 10:00 in the morning with mist can be just as impressive as it is at 6:00 with sun, and during some months of the year the early-morning mist does not clear until well into the morning.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<h2 class=\"wp-block-heading\">Third: Contact Authorized Agencies in Cusco Directly<\/h2>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">Agencies authorized by the Ministry of Culture have access to the same reservation system as the official portal, but some manage blocks of spaces assigned in advance that do not always appear on the public portal in real time. Circuit 2, which includes the upper viewpoint with the site\u2019s most famous panoramic view, is by far the most requested. Circuits 3, 4, and 5 usually have greater availability, especially for first-entry time slots.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<figure class=\"wp-block-image size-large\"><img loading=\"lazy\" decoding=\"async\" width=\"1024\" height=\"683\" src=\"https:\/\/incredibleperutours.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/Machu-Picchu-ciruito-2-1024x683.jpg\" alt=\"\" class=\"wp-image-7314\" srcset=\"https:\/\/incredibleperutours.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/Machu-Picchu-ciruito-2-1024x683.jpg 1024w, https:\/\/incredibleperutours.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/Machu-Picchu-ciruito-2-300x200.jpg 300w, https:\/\/incredibleperutours.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/Machu-Picchu-ciruito-2-768x512.jpg 768w, https:\/\/incredibleperutours.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/Machu-Picchu-ciruito-2-1536x1025.jpg 1536w, https:\/\/incredibleperutours.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/Machu-Picchu-ciruito-2.jpg 2000w\" sizes=\"auto, (max-width: 1024px) 100vw, 1024px\" \/><figcaption class=\"wp-element-caption\">Machu Picchu Circuit 2<\/figcaption><\/figure>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">Circuit 4 includes access to the section of the historic trail that reaches the Sun Gate, Inti Punku, and offers one of the most impressive perspectives of the site from above. It is not the circuit shown in the main photo of most tourist brochures, but for someone with strong legs and enough time inside the site, it creates images and experiences that Circuit 2 cannot offer. If Circuit 2 is sold out but Circuit 4 has availability, choosing Circuit 4 is not a plan B: it is a different experience with its own value.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<figure class=\"wp-block-image size-large\"><img loading=\"lazy\" decoding=\"async\" width=\"1024\" height=\"576\" src=\"https:\/\/incredibleperutours.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/Inti-Punku-1024x576.jpeg\" alt=\"Inti Punku\" class=\"wp-image-6475\" srcset=\"https:\/\/incredibleperutours.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/Inti-Punku-1024x576.jpeg 1024w, https:\/\/incredibleperutours.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/Inti-Punku-300x169.jpeg 300w, https:\/\/incredibleperutours.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/Inti-Punku-768x432.jpeg 768w, https:\/\/incredibleperutours.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/Inti-Punku-1536x864.jpeg 1536w, https:\/\/incredibleperutours.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/Inti-Punku.jpeg 1600w\" sizes=\"auto, (max-width: 1024px) 100vw, 1024px\" \/><figcaption class=\"wp-element-caption\">Circuit 4 Inti Punku<\/figcaption><\/figure>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">Circuit 5, which includes the trail to the Inca suspension bridge, also has greater availability than Circuit 2 on most days. It is the least known circuit and the one with fewer simultaneous groups on the trail, creating a more solitary and intimate experience within the archaeological complex.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<h2 class=\"wp-block-heading\">Fifth: Consider an Alternative visit Within the Region<\/h2>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">If Machu Picchu availability for your travel dates is truly sold out across all circuits and time slots, there are archaeological sites in the Cusco region that offer a historically rich experience without the quotas and restrictions of the most famous site.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">Choquequirao is the strongest alternative. It is located two days on foot from the nearest access point, has an extension comparable to Machu Picchu, and receives only a few dozen visitors per day because its limited accessibility keeps it away from mass tourism. The Peruvian government has plans to install a cable car that, once operational, will completely change that situation. But while it is not yet operating, Choquequirao remains one of the most extraordinary and least visited archaeological sites in all of South America.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">Ollantaytambo has a first-rate archaeological site of its own, with monumental terraces and the unfinished Temple of the Sun, which the Incas abandoned during the Spanish conquest. Pisac has a complex of terraces and ceremonial enclosures overlooking the Sacred Valley that, in terms of scenic beauty, has nothing to envy Machu Picchu. Moray, with its concentric circular terraces interpreted as an Inca agricultural laboratory, is one of the most unique examples of experimental architecture on the continent.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">None of these sites replaces Machu Picchu as an experience, but they are not minor consolation prizes either. They are extraordinary places with their own identity that most travelers usually overlook because Machu Picchu concentrates all the attention in the itinerary.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<figure class=\"wp-block-image size-large\"><img loading=\"lazy\" decoding=\"async\" width=\"1024\" height=\"768\" src=\"https:\/\/incredibleperutours.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/Tour-Ollantaytambo-1024x768.webp\" alt=\"Sacred Valley of the Incas tour\" class=\"wp-image-7435\" srcset=\"https:\/\/incredibleperutours.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/Tour-Ollantaytambo-1024x768.webp 1024w, https:\/\/incredibleperutours.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/Tour-Ollantaytambo-300x225.webp 300w, https:\/\/incredibleperutours.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/Tour-Ollantaytambo-768x576.webp 768w, https:\/\/incredibleperutours.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/Tour-Ollantaytambo-1536x1152.webp 1536w, https:\/\/incredibleperutours.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/Tour-Ollantaytambo-2048x1536.webp 2048w, https:\/\/incredibleperutours.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/Tour-Ollantaytambo-600x450.webp 600w\" sizes=\"auto, (max-width: 1024px) 100vw, 1024px\" \/><figcaption class=\"wp-element-caption\">Sacred Valley of the Incas Tour<\/figcaption><\/figure>\n\n\n\n<h2 class=\"wp-block-heading\">Sixth: Reach the Site Through the Inca Trail or the Salkantay Trek<\/h2>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">This option requires more time than most travelers with flights already purchased usually have available, but it is worth mentioning because it turns the problem into an opportunity. A ticket purchased under another person\u2019s name does not allow entry to the site. Tickets resold on unofficial platforms are almost always fraudulent or belong to the seller, making them unusable for the buyer.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">Arriving at the site without a ticket hoping to buy one at the ticket office is not viable either. Machu Picchu does not sell tickets at the gate on the same day of the visit: all access requires a ticket purchased in advance through the official portal or through an authorized agency. Anyone who arrives at the entrance without a ticket simply does not enter.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">Trying to enter during hours with less control does not work either. Park rangers verify tickets at all access points to the site throughout opening hours, and attempts to enter without a ticket have administrative consequences for those who try.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<h2 class=\"wp-block-heading\">The Advice That Avoids This Problem Completely<\/h2>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">The only definitive solution to the problem of sold-out tickets is to manage them before buying the flight, not afterward. The official Ministry of Culture portal opens ticket sales several months in advance, and checking availability for the travel dates before committing to any transportation expense is the step that turns a potential problem into a non-problem from the very beginning of the planning process.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">Do you have fixed travel dates and want to check whether Machu Picchu tickets are available, or whether the Inca Trail or Salkantay Trek are viable options for those dates?
